Poor pay but make your own schedule

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

The patients. Like an independent practice, creating own schedule, have control over which patients you see (e.g. can fire a patient for non-compliance). Supervisors are kind.

Cons

Extremely poor, unlivable wages. Company is poorly organized. Employees are required to put in time that is unpaid. E.g. multiple tasks are unpaid such as care coordination, phone calls to MD offices and patients/families. There is an expectation that clinicians are "on call" to answer email and phone calls throughout the day, even if seeing one patient during the day. There is high staff turnover due to poor pay.
